WebbA shark's liver is made of two large lobes that concentrate and store oils and fatty acids. The liver functions in energy storage and buoyancy. A shark's liver is relatively large, … Webb25 jan. 2024 · Yes, sharks do have kidneys, although they are different from the human variety. WebbThe left kidney is located at about the T12 to L3 vertebrae, whereas the right is lower due to slight displacement by the liver. Upper portions of the kidneys are somewhat protected by the eleventh and twelfth ribs ( Figure 25.7 ). Each kidney weighs about 125–175 g in males and 115–155 g in females. (2) changing seasons. (3) revolving. (4) rotating. description of healthy skinWebbDogfish Digestive Tract. Use scissors to cut through the body wall. Make your longitudinal cut off center from the midventral line and out to the pectoral and pelvic fins, then turn back the flaps. Note the falciform ligament hanging midventrally from the liver in the anterior half of the pleuroperitoneal cavity. description of health care providers
